The Advantages of Co-education

Private co educational schools Melbourne has numerous benefits. First and foremost, co-educational institutions offer pupils a more diverse social context in which to engage with peers of all genders. This promotes understanding, respect, and communication skills, which are critical for success in today’s interconnected world.

Furthermore, studying with pupils of diverse genders fosters healthy rivalry and collaboration among peers. This relationship frequently leads to improved academic achievement as students encourage one another to excel academically.

Furthermore, co-education encourages a balanced view of gender roles and relationships, preparing students for a real-world environment in which men and women collaborate in a variety of capacities.

The benefits of co-education go beyond academics and include social development and preparation for future professional roles.

How to Select the Right Private Co-Educational School for Your Child?

When selecting the best private co-educational school for your child, consider academic excellence, extracurricular options, location, and the school’s beliefs and culture. Make time to visit each potential school, speak with current students and parents, and attend open houses or information sessions. Trust your intuition and select a school where you believe your child will succeed academically and personally. Remember that each child is unique, and what works for one may not work for another. By making an informed selection based on your child’s needs and interests, you may help them succeed academically and personally.
